The invention relates to a Pseudobagrus fulvidraco feed. The invention is characterized in that the Pseudobagrus fulvidraco feed comprises the following raw materials in parts by weight: 0.5-0.8 part of silicate bacterium, 1-3 parts of Streptococcus faecalis, 0.6-0.8 part of Trichoderma, 2-5 parts of Rhodopseudomonas palustris, 0.3-0.5 part of microzyme, 50-60 parts of fishbone dust, 65-70 parts of vinegar residue powder, 50-55 parts of waste liquor precipitate, 40-60 parts of rice bran, 12-14 parts of brown sugar, 10-14 parts of table salt, 80-85 parts of pig manure, 45-55 parts of pork abattoir waste, 60-65 parts of aquatic, 12-16 parts of calcium bicarbonate, 14-17 parts of urea, 1-3 parts of ferric citrate, 0.6-0.8 part of vitamin B1, 0.2-0.6 part of vitamin B12, 20-30 parts of pepper and the like.
